Either Richards or EJ should go out and set the high screen, with the other posting on the low block. Then the screener should roll to the basket while the other big gives him some space via a back screen or just blocking out his man and preventing him from rotating over.

That way we either get an open shot with one big ready to rebound and the other rolling in also ready to grab a carom, or we get the ball to the rolling big for a layup, or a pass to the big on the block. It could be a beautiful thing if both Nick and EJ swear off the 12-15' jumper and decide to "man up" and play strong in the paint.
